No Guarantee of Results
Marketing performance can be influenced by many factors outside Cultivate’s control, including market conditions, competition, advertising budgets, platform policies, website performance, pricing and offers, client response times, sales processes, customer demand, third-party systems, and changes made by advertising or technology platforms.
Cultivate may provide strategy, recommendations, implementation, management, or support, but does not guarantee specific revenue, profit, leads, patients, customers, appointments, rankings, advertising performance, return on investment, or business growth. Examples, estimates, projections, and prior results are not promises of future performance.
